Great Rhymers Make Great Readers Project 2025


We will be hosting several music sessions over the course of 2025 as part of our Great Rhymers Make Great Readers project. The sessions will be provided by Kathy Seabrook Fun Music and Harminis Music and will take place in the library on different days and times throughout the year.
These sessions are suitable for babies and children under 5 and their parents/carers. Booking is essential as places are limited. Details of the next session will be announced on our Facebook page.
Family Activities
We aim to support families in our community by holding a range of activities throughout the year at weekends and during the school holidays.



In the past few years we have organised everything from craft days to Halloween trails; Dengineers weeks to water safety days; playdough discos to bear hunts. We enjoy experimenting with new ideas and are always led by the needs and imaginations of the children and families in our community.
